link182 Posted June 2, 2023 Posted June 2, 2023 Hi I wanted to know if someone had managed to emulate with mame the super a'can. I put the rom in the rom\supracan folder but do not start I know that does not need bios can you help me? Thank you Quote
JoeViking245 Posted June 2, 2023 Posted June 2, 2023 On 6/1/2023 at 5:59 PM, link182 said: Hi I wanted to know if someone had managed to emulate with mame the super a'can. I put the rom in the rom\supracan folder but do not start I know that does not need bios can you help me? Thank you Because it's a MAME softList console, you need to add supracan to the default command-line parameter for that [Associated] platform. (It will work without having to also add -cart.) To test Monopoly from the command prompt, you'd simply type: mame.exe supracan monopoly And since you now know it works there, it'll work when launched from LaunchBox. But of the 11 games available, only 5 are noted as working. So make sure to test with one of those 5. Quote
link182 Posted June 3, 2023 Author Posted June 3, 2023 hello I managed to start monopoly but now I have 2 problems, the first problem is if I try to start one of the other 5 games I always start monopoly, the second problem is to add them and make them start on launchbox them gives me an error message. thanks for the availability Quote
JoeViking245 Posted June 3, 2023 Posted June 3, 2023 3 hours ago, link182 said: start on launchbox them gives me an error message Like..... what sort of message? Do you have the games (ROMs) imported into LaunchBox? In LaunchBox, when you edit your MAME emulator, under Associated Platforms, did you set the Default Command-line Parameter for that platform to just "supracan" (without quotes)? Or did you put the full [test] parameters "supracan monopoly"? Quote
link182 Posted June 3, 2023 Author Posted June 3, 2023 Hello solved for the rom I had to put everything on mame (mameui always started the same game) and for the rom I anyway insert -cart. Now everything works, you were very kind P.S. last thing you know apple pippin it's emulable with mame? thanks 1 Quote
JoeViking245 Posted June 3, 2023 Posted June 3, 2023 16 minutes ago, link182 said: Hello solved for the rom I had to put everything on mame (mameui always started the same game) and for the rom I anyway insert -cart. Now everything works, you were very kind P.S. last thing you know apple pippin it's emulable with mame? thanks Glad it's working for you now. Pippin? You pick the oddest systems to emulate. lol According to this site, it should [somewhat] work: Pippin @mark - MAME machine (arcadeitalia.net) Note that it uses CDROMs (.chd files) and requires a System ROM (pippin.zip) and a Device ROM (cuda.zip). You'll need to search around on how to make that all work correctly as I've never tested it and (no offense) don't plan to. Quote
link182 Posted June 3, 2023 Author Posted June 3, 2023 yes the most known ones I have them all so I try to insert others, thanks a lot again 1 Quote
xokia Posted Wednesday at 01:08 AM Posted Wednesday at 01:08 AM This one seems like it should be easy after getting mame to work. But For some reason I cant get this one to work. My understanding is that this one should not need a bios. But then I found elsewhere where folks say create an empty file called internal_68k.bin and zip it into supracan.zip. I've tried both cant get it to load the game. What am I missing? Quote
JoeViking245 Posted Wednesday at 01:24 AM Posted Wednesday at 01:24 AM 9 minutes ago, xokia said: This one seems like it should be easy after getting mame to work. But For some reason I cant get this one to work. My understanding is that this one should not need a bios. But then I found elsewhere where folks say create an empty file called internal_68k.bin and zip it into supracan.zip. I've tried both cant get it to load the game. What am I missing? Since you have remove quotes checked and remove file extension.. unchecked, maybe try adding like you have the others "supracan \"%romfile%\"" or "supracan -cart \"%romfile%\"" Quote
xokia Posted Wednesday at 01:50 AM Posted Wednesday at 01:50 AM Yea I initially tried that. no luck Quote
JoeViking245 Posted Wednesday at 03:09 AM Posted Wednesday at 03:09 AM 1 hour ago, xokia said: Yea I initially tried that. no luck And it loads just fine when you load it directly from RetroArch? Have you tried stand-alone MAME? Beyond that, unless you have an affinity for the system, seems like a lot of work for 5 working games. Quote
xokia Posted Wednesday at 04:29 AM Posted Wednesday at 04:29 AM (edited) 2 hours ago, JoeViking245 said: And it loads just fine when you load it directly from RetroArch? Have you tried stand-alone MAME? Beyond that, unless you have an affinity for the system, seems like a lot of work for 5 working games. Yea you are probably right. I'm not really even a gamer. I mainly do this to learn something new and for my nieces and nephews. They are able to log into my server from a firestick and play whatever they want. I was able to get the retroarch console logger working. Looks like it detects the system correctly [libretro DEBUG] Path extraction result: Game path = "Z:\Arcade\Funtech Super Acan\Roms" [libretro DEBUG] Path extraction result: Parent path = "Z:\Arcade\Funtech Super Acan" [libretro INFO] Starting game from command line: "supracan "Z:\Arcade\Funtech Super Acan\Roms\Boom Zoo (Taiwan).7z"" [libretro DEBUG] Searching for driver: supracan [libretro DEBUG] System type: CONSOLE [libretro INFO] Game name: supracan [libretro INFO] Game description: Super A'Can Then detects the bios correctly [libretro DEBUG] Z:\Arcade\emulators\Launchbox_RetroArch\RetroArch-Win64\system\mame\ [libretro DEBUG] -rompath [libretro DEBUG] Z:\Arcade\Funtech Super Acan\Roms;Z:\Arcade\emulators\Launchbox_RetroArch\RetroArch-Win64\system\mame\bios;Z:\Arcade\emulators\Launchbox_RetroArch\RetroArch-Win64\system\mame\roms [libretro DEBUG] supracan [libretro DEBUG] Z:\Arcade\Funtech Super Acan\Roms\Boom Zoo (Taiwan).7z But then fails to match he name? Not sure what to make of that error message [libretro ERROR] "\Arcade\Funtech Super Acan\Roms\Boom Zoo (Taiwan).7z" approximately matches the following supported software items (best match first): [libretro ERROR] * Software list "supracan" (Funtech Super A'Can cartridges) matches: [libretro ERROR] slghtsag Super Light Saga - Dragon Force ~ Chao Ji Guang Ming Zhan Shi [libretro ERROR] monopoly Monopoly: Adventure in Africa ~ Fei Zhou Tan Xian Da Fu Weng [libretro ERROR] sangofgt Sango Fighter ~ Wu Jiang Zheng Ba - San Guo Zhi [libretro ERROR] magipool Magical Pool [libretro ERROR] speedyd Speedy Dragon ~ Yin Su Fei Long [libretro ERROR] staiwbbl Super Taiwanese Baseball League ~ Chao Ji Zhong Hua Zhi Bang Lian Meng [libretro ERROR] formduel Formosa Duel [libretro ERROR] sonevil The Son of Evil ~ Xie E Zhi Zi [libretro ERROR] jttlaugh Journey to the Laugh ~ Xi You Ji [libretro ERROR] boomzoo Boom Zoo ~ Bao Bao Dong Wu Yuan [libretro ERROR] gamblord Gambling Lord [libretro ERROR] [libretro ERROR] [libretro DEBUG] retro_load_game osd_sleep [libretro DEBUG] retro_load_game osd_sleep done [ERROR] [Content]: Failed to load content [INFO] [Core]: Content ran for a total of: 00 hours, 00 minutes, 00 seconds. [INFO] [Core]: Unloading core.. And no to MAME directly. I get a similar message. Edited Wednesday at 05:29 AM by xokia Quote
launchretrogirl2562 Posted Wednesday at 05:12 AM Posted Wednesday at 05:12 AM these are the names it expects. (see screenshot or u can try edit your opt file (\RetroArch\config\MAME\supracan.opt) and disable softlists mame_softlists_enable = "disabled" 1 Quote
xokia Posted Wednesday at 06:57 AM Posted Wednesday at 06:57 AM 1 hour ago, launchretrogirl2562 said: these are the names it expects. (see screenshot or u can try edit your opt file (\RetroArch\config\MAME\supracan.opt) and disable softlists mame_softlists_enable = "disabled" I don't have a (\RetroArch\config\MAME\supracan.opt) All the files in \RetroArch\config\MAME\ are .cfg files Can I just create a supracan.cfg file and then add mame_softlists_enable = "disabled" to it? Quote
JoeViking245 Posted Wednesday at 11:31 AM Posted Wednesday at 11:31 AM 4 hours ago, xokia said: I don't have a (\RetroArch\config\MAME\supracan.opt) All the files in \RetroArch\config\MAME\ are .cfg files Can I just create a supracan.cfg file and then add mame_softlists_enable = "disabled" to it? Of just rename the file from Boom Zoo (Taiwan).7z to boomzoo.7z. 1 Quote
launchretrogirl2562 Posted Wednesday at 03:13 PM Posted Wednesday at 03:13 PM 8 hours ago, xokia said: I don't have a (\RetroArch\config\MAME\supracan.opt) All the files in \RetroArch\config\MAME\ are .cfg files Can I just create a supracan.cfg file and then add mame_softlists_enable = "disabled" to it? Here are my examples. In the opt, you either change the mame_softlists to disabled. Or you as JoeViking mentioned...you change your romnames to the required ones supracan.cfg supracan.opt 1 Quote
xokia Posted Wednesday at 04:33 PM Posted Wednesday at 04:33 PM (edited) 8 hours ago, JoeViking245 said: Of just rename the file from Boom Zoo (Taiwan).7z to boomzoo.7z. Trying to learn the system too. So learning the file structure and options is preferable to me 4 hours ago, launchretrogirl2562 said: Here are my examples. In the opt, you either change the mame_softlists to disabled. Or you as JoeViking mentioned...you change your romnames to the required ones Ok so you dont need to update anything with the path to the opt file retroarch will just pick it up if it exists? Tried both methods neither seemed to work. But learned something new about the opt and cfg files thank you. 18 hours ago, JoeViking245 said: Since you have remove quotes checked and remove file extension.. unchecked, maybe try adding like you have the others "supracan \"%romfile%\"" or "supracan -cart \"%romfile%\"" I did find the issue. Not sure what I missed the first time through. Maybe I didnt have the bios correct first time through. Even though it says a bios is not needed it appears one is needed. The -cart is required both in MAME(0.274) directly and retroarch . Think I read somewhere it was optional for this system. with -cart and not changing anything else everything works. -f "supracan -cart \"%romfile%\"" Edited Wednesday at 08:00 PM by xokia Quote
Recommended Posts
Join the conversation
You can post now and register later. If you have an account, sign in now to post with your account.